Schema Therapy - Psychology Tools Schema therapy (ST) is an integrative approach that brings together elements from cognitive behavioral therapy, attachment and object relations theories, and Gestalt and experiential therapies. It was introduced by Jeff Young in 1990 and has been developed and refined since then.

SCHEMA THERAPY: CONCEPTUAL MODEL - Guilford Press Once acute symptoms have abated, schema therapy is appropriate for the treatment of many Axis I and Axis II disorders that have a significant basis in lifelong characterological themes. Application Schema Therapy - Getselfhelp.co.uk Schema Therapy was developed by Jeffrey Young, to treat individuals with Borderline Personality Disorder, but can also be used with other presentations caused by difficult childhood experiences.
